Title :
Implementation of high speed Viterbi detectors

Abstract :
The normal Viterbi architecture and a radix 4 architecture are compared with a parallel ACS version using a latch based storage element. Results obtained using an eight-state EPR4 Viterbi detector show that parallel ACS architectures can provide a high level of performance with modest area requirements
